自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(9)
  • 收藏
  • 关注

原创 安全{}.hasOwnProperty.call检测

在不确定变量类型的情况下安全地进行属性检测,从而提高代码的健壮性和容错能力。

2024-10-28 09:46:47 316

原创 从同步代码、异步代码、宏任务、微任务的角度分析代码执行顺序

这类代码按照编写的顺序逐行执行。每一行代码必须执行完毕后,下一行代码才会开始执行。如果中间某段代码阻塞了(例如进行长时间计算),那么后续代码都会等待该段代码执行完毕。

2024-10-23 17:19:43 742

原创 js中你不太了解的【词法作用域】

刷新你对作用域链的理解!前端必须之词法作用域!

2024-10-15 17:31:12 399

原创 URLSearchParams 表单数据序列化与反序列化、管理路由状态、分享和书签功能、追踪和分析等7种应用场景

URLSearchParams7种应用场景

2024-06-18 12:27:22 754

原创 JavaScript数据类型与存储方式

数据类型与存储方式

2024-06-06 14:14:37 416

原创 观察者模式(简易版)

前端设计模式,学浅,轻喷

2024-05-30 11:48:47 363

原创 weakMap的缓存

weakMap使用场景

2024-05-30 11:02:17 287

原创 变量提前声明并未赋值问题

变量提前声明并未赋值问题 var name = 'daisy'; (function(){ if(name === 'daisy'){ console.log('Hello '+name); }else{ console.log('goodbye '+name); var name = 'lazy'; } }()); //输出为 goodby...

2019-06-26 09:58:25 1306

原创 浅谈filter+indexOf数组去重

浅谈filter+indexOf数组去重filter方法indexOf方法filter方法array.filter(function(currentValue,index,arr), thisValue);filter() 方法创建一个新的数组,新数组中的元素是通过检查指定数组中符合条件(匿名函数中的条件)的所有元素;indexOf方法stringObject.indexOf(searc...

2019-06-16 10:59:17 2239

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除